This study aims to examine the contribution of sustainable practices to the creation of memorable customer experiences (CXs) in upscale restaurants, especially Michelin Green Star Restaurants (MGSRs). This research adopts a qualitative approach, employing the Gioia methodology to analyze the interviews with MGSRs’ managers and chefs, as well as the content of the restaurants’ corporate websites. In the findings, we identify the sustainable practices adopted by MGSRs to enhance CX memorability and classify them based on the theoretical dimensions of the hospitality experience. Finally, we propose a framework that integrates the sustainable practices implemented by MGSRs within the dimensions of functionality, authenticity, emotionality, engagement, and expressivity in hospitality CX. In this circular process, the partnerships developed among local suppliers, chefs, staff, and customers play a fundamental role in creating memorable CXs. This study combines and extends the literature on CX memorability and sustainable practices in upscale restaurants and provides practical suggestions to restaurant managers.
